BELAGAVI: Nandagad police of Belgaum district on Friday intercepted and arrested three accused connected to the poaching of a deer at Bidi village near here. Police also seized the carcass  and weapons from the accused.

According to police sources, the accused shot the deer in a private land within Golihalli Forest Range of Khanapur taluk in Belgaum district. They were carrying the dead deer in their vehicle on Alnawar- Bidi Road when police were alerted.

The accused have been identified as Parveez Samsheer (38), Shaikh Navaz Samsheer (38) and Mehaboob Kittur (31), all residents of Bidi village. Another accused identified as Amjad Hussian of Shirshi is absconding.

Acting swiftly, police intercepted the vehicle near Kuber Dhaba at the entrance of Bidi. While the three accused were arrested, Hussian managed to escape.

Police have seized a single barrel rifle, a double barrel rifle, 2 sharp weapons and the scorpio jeep in which they were travelling. A case has been registered by Nandagad police.
